in 2019 it has become standard practice to sign a document on the web simply by typing in your name. most countries around the world now have laws in place to accept electronic signatures. so if you’re wondering if the digital signature on your waivers or other documents makes them legally enforceable, read on to learn more. in some cases, all you need to do is type your name and acknowledge your consent. all of these laws require certain factors to be in place for an e-signature to be legally binding and protect signers. a signature on an electronic document is legal only if the document and clauses within are fully transparent and the signature is made with intent. all electronic documents/signing platforms should include a clause that the client agrees to sign this agreement electronically.

the answer is in the requirement to maintain a digital audit trail that associates the signature with unique signifiers such as a timestamp, email and ip address. all signatures must be attached securely to the document and not stored separately. signed documents should be stored in an encrypted environment and not sent to anyone aside from the parties involved. upon signing a document, a copy of the document including the signature must be sent to the client. you also need to keep the signed copies of each document to be reproduced when required. last but not least, a client should always have the opportunity to opt-out of digital signing in favor of signing a paper contract. while digital is the new norm, you should always have paper backups in the event of someone choosing to go this route. businesses can also choose to set up our waiver app as a sign-in kiosk.
